Avoiding Surface Area Preparation



Among the largest blunders you can make when residence painting is skipping surface preparation. This critical action lays the foundation for an effective paint task. If you do not cleanse the surfaces, dust and grime can hinder paint bond, resulting in peeling off or cracking down the line. You want your paint to stick, so get hold of a sponge or a stress washer and reach work.

Next off, evaluate the surface for any flaws like cracks or openings. Filling up these gaps with spackle or caulk makes sure a smooth coating. Do not ignore sanding; it helps produce a texture that permits the paint to stick far better.

After sanding, clean away the dust to make certain a tidy surface area.

Priming is an additional vital part of prep work. It not just boosts paint attachment but also offers an uniform base, particularly if you're repainting over a darker color or a glossy finish. Choosing Incompatible Paint



When it concerns house paint, choosing the right paint is vital for achieving an enduring surface. If you pick inappropriate paint, you could wind up with peeling, gurgling, or uneven coverage.

It's vital to think about the surface area you're repainting. As an example, making use of exterior paint inside your home can release dangerous fumes, while indoor paint won't hold up against the aspects outside.

You likewise require to take notice of the type of finish you desire. Shiny paints are great for high-traffic locations but can highlight flaws, while matte paints can absorb light and create a comfy feel. Make sure the paint is suitable for the particular surface area product-- timber, drywall, or metal-- as each calls for a various formulation.

Additionally, take into consideration the color you're selecting. Some colors may need a specific base or primer to achieve the desired color, while others might clash with existing decoration.

Don't forget compatibility with previous layers; painting over oil-based paint with water-based paint can cause bond problems.

Disregarding Weather Condition Issues



Disregarding weather can mean disaster for your painting project, as extreme temperatures and moisture levels substantially impact paint application and drying times. If it's too hot, paint can dry also quickly, bring about undesirable splits and peeling off. On the other hand, reduced temperatures can cause the paint to thicken, making it difficult to use equally.

Humidity plays a vital duty as well. High moisture can extend drying out times and trigger the paint to draw in moisture, which may bring about bubbling and blistering. Preferably, you should intend to repaint when temperatures vary between 50 ° F and 85 ° F, with humidity listed below 70%.

Prior to you start, examine the weather forecast for the day of your project and a couple of days in advance. If rainfall is on the horizon, postpone your painting till the skies clear. Additionally, think about the moment of day; late afternoon and early evening usually provide ideal conditions as temperature levels cool down.

Rushing the Drying Process



Rushing the drying out procedure can bring about a host of problems that threaten your hard work. When you rush with drying out, you run the risk of trapping moisture beneath the paint, which can trigger gurgling, peeling off, or discoloration.

You might think you can conserve time by applying a 2nd layer too soon, however this can create a sticky mess that damages the surface.

To avoid this error, always examine the maker's suggestions for drying times. Aspects like moisture and temperature can dramatically influence the length of time it considers paint to dry. If the problems aren't ideal, it's best to wait a bit longer.

Using followers or dehumidifiers can help quicken the procedure without endangering the high quality of your work. Nevertheless, do not count entirely on these methods-- persistence is vital.
